How To Get Started with Online Betting
Step 1: Choose a Reputable Betting Site
Start by selecting a licensed and regulated online bookmaker. Look for reviews and ratings that give insight into their reliability and customer service.
Step 2: Create an Account
Once you’ve chosen a site, register for an account. You’ll need to provide some personal details such as your name, email address, and date of birth.
Step 3: Make Your First Deposit
Most sites offer various payment methods including credit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. Ensure you understand any fees or bonuses associated with your first deposit.
Step 4: Explore Your Options
Dive into the different types of bets available—single bets, accumulators, or even in-play betting once you’re comfortable. Each type has its own intricacies.
Step 5: Start Small
If you’re new to betting, begin with smaller amounts until you feel confident in your understanding of the odds and outcomes.
